So first up is the Creamy Candy bubble bar, I have always seen this in the shops but for some reason just never tried it, I’m a big fan of the Melting Marshmallow Moment, and thought it smelt really similar so never thought to defer until now – a group of people were standing in front of my Marshmallow Moment so I decided to make a grab for this instead and I’m so glad I did. It’s pretty sizeable so I reckon I have a couple of uses of this one (I like to mix my lush bits together to make my own smells!)
The next thing I made a grab for was one of my all time favourites The Comforter. I love everything about this one, it’s huge so lasts a while, and turns my bath into a lovely pink colour with so many bubbles! It is also one of those that has a smell that lasts for hours, and I love once I’ve had a bath the scent fills my house and everyone comments on it.

Fifth is one of my favs from last Christmas – So White. These went into the sale after Christmas last year, and with no word of a lie I bought 10, I love them so much. It smells like apples and once it is dropped into the bath it explodes into a rose coloured centre. The smell isn’t a traditional Christmas smell, but I am pretty glad about that, one smell I hate the most is Cranberry, and for some reason every Christmas product usually features it.
Next up is Dragons Egg, another lush classic. This bath bomb is crazy, it crackles and pops as soon as you drop it in and fizzes into a bright orange colour with the addition of bright coloured confetti, this is another one with a lingering smell, and I am not usually one for citrus but there is something about this one that I can overlook.
Second from last is another part of the Lush Christmas collection – Butterbear. I had such high hopes for this one, it reminded me a little of Ickle Baby Bot and it really does smell delicious, the predominant scent being coco butter – which we all know is great for your skin, but this just didn’t work for me. I think it has something to do with the colour, I like there to be almost a show with my bath products, and my favourite part is seeing all of the colours and strong smells and this just lacks a little in both. It also didn’t really make my skin seem any softer so a little disappointed with this one. It is incredibly cute though, and I can imagine if you had kids or you didn’t like over powering smells then it would be great.
And last up is Father Christmas himself. I think it might just be my nose I feel like he smells different this year, which in all honesty is what made me buy him again. It says on the website that it is the same scent as Snow Fairy – which I can definitely tell. But I don’t know if it is different from last year, maybe someone can shed some light on that one for me 🙂 What is the same as last year though is the bright colours that spin out in shades of red and green.
